I am in California for the weekend from NY I was planning on taking the amtrak from LA to Solana beach this sunday June 6, 2010. But i know see the train will only take me as far as Irvine. Should I scuttle my plans or fly to San Diego? recommendations please. Very unfamiliar with the Area!!!!

I've taken Amtrak all the way to Solana Beach several times, so just checked the schedule to see what was going on; I see that for some reason the train itself on Sunday goes only to Irvine (too bad, as the most beautiful part of the train ride is south of there), but there's an Amtrak connector bus that will bring you the rest of the way. You can book tickets on the website. (I haven't been on a bus on that route, but in general it's very easy -- they meet the train, you get on, it drops you off at the Solana Beach station.)

In any case, I wouldn't fly from LA to SD; you'd be spending almost as or even more time getting to and from the airports and checking in as you would be on the train or bus.

We do Union Station to Solana Beach all the time. Just go to the station with ID and buy your ticket. It takes about two hours and you'll have a nice ocean view if you travel during the day.
